Pentecost 2025
Fifty days after Easter and ten days after Ascension Day, Christians celebrate another holiday: Pentecost. The name of the holiday comes from the Greek word “pentakosta,” which means “fiftieth.” On this “fiftieth” day, Christians around the world celebrate the coming of the Holy Spirit and the “birthday” of the church.
